According to Fox Sports.com Jake Long's deal is five years (sixth year is voidable) for $57M with $30M guaranteed.
The Rams can go with Chris Long, Glenn Dorsey or Vernon Gholston.
There have been rumors though that the Saints want to trade up to #2 and select Dorsey.
